Catalog description

The goal of this course is to assist professionals to turn their own Six Sigma projects into reality. This course will guide the students through all aspects of Six Sigma from identifying and defining a suitable project topic, to sustainably managing its success in the control phase. By demonstrating all of the necessary steps supported by a “Define, Measure, Analyze, Improve, Control” (DMAIC) software guide, it makes the application of the sequentially linked DMAIC tools transferable to typical Six Sigma business projects. This course will give students the knowledge and confidence to continue their studies to take the Green Belt certification.
